WebIf you are in high school and your school uses a weighted GPA scale, an A in an Advanced Placement or Honors course is worth 5 points. Bs are worth 4 points. Cs are worth 3 points. Ds are worth 2 points. Fs are not worth any points. Now add up all of the points. Count the number of courses you wrote on your list. "If they make one tiny mistake ... WebWeighted High School GPA = Σ (Weighted grade point equivalent)/ Σ courses. Weighted High School GPA = (4.5 + 2.4 + 3 + 4.6) / 4 = 14.5 / 4 = 3.625 ≈ 3.63 (usually, GPA is rounded to 2 digits) To calculate weighted GPA high school you can try the above cumulative gpa calculator high school.
